Best Bet

St George Illawarra +5.5
Line

St George Illawarra have been highly impressive over the last fortnight in rolling Top 8 teams Canberra and Cronulla and they can add another scalp with the Warriors this Friday in Auckland.

The Dragons have been hit hard by injury but continue to put in. Their record against Top 8 teams is to be admired with seven covers in their last nine against teams in the finals mix.

This is also a handy spot for the Dragons as a big outsider with the Dragons covering nine of their last 12 getting a start of at least a try. St George IIlawarra ave lost only three matches by more than eight points this season.

The Dragons also have an excellent night record with a 14-5 cover record in evening matches.

The Warriors are 6-14 ATS as a favourite and a 9-19 cover record when favoured by a try or more. They are 8-14 ATS at Mt Smart.

Chips in the Dragons.


Same Game Multi

Tyrell Sloan Try/Clint Gutherson Try
Same Game Multi

Tyrell Sloan is having a sensational tryscoring season with 16 tries in 17 matches that has him second on the tryscoring list.

Clint Gutherson loves playing the Warriors with six tries in 10 matches including in each of the last three.


Value Bet

Jacob Liddle
To Score A Try

Jacob Liddle continues to be underrated tryscorer who is over the odds each and every week. Liddle has eight tries in 20 games yet goes around at about the $6 quote every week. He is a big chance of crossing against a Warriors team that got decimated through the middle.
